The Brazilian guitarist, Paulo Pedrassoli has been unanimously applauded by both critics and public ever since his triumphal performance at the V VILLA-LOBOS INTERNATIONAL GUITAR COMPETITION in 1992. Today, at 29 Paulo is master of his own personalized style, distinguished by his extraordinary reverberance. In Brazil he was a pupil of Ricardo Wolff, Leo Soares and Henrique Pinto. His studies have also taken him to Italy where he studied with Luigi Mercuri. Seven times prize-winner in competitions, notably: 1st Prize and “Best Interpreter of Brazilian Music” award in the V VILLA-LOBOS NATIONAL GUITAR COMPETITION in 1990. In 1992, he won 2nd prize in the V VILLA-LOBOS INTERNATIONAL GUITAR COMPETITION (Rio). He participated in the 5th Eldorado Prize Competition (São Paulo) and in the “42nd Internationaler Musikwettbewerb der ARD” in Munich. Paulo has performed Joaquín Rodrigo's “Concierto de Aranjuez” and Villa-Lobos' “Concerto for Guitar and Small Orchestra” with leading Brazilian orchestras. He has also recorded national programs for TVE - Educational Television (Rio de Janeiro) and TV Cultura - Cultural TV (São Paulo) and most recently in the XI Bienal de Música Contemporânea (RJ). His International début, a recital in the Bibliotheksaal des Klosters Wiblingen in Ulm, Germany in 1995 was a huge success. (Having to return to the stage 5 times.)
